Provides physical conditioning, reconditioning, risk factor reduction, and education by prescribing, conducting, and evaluating cardiovascular and metabolic exercise programs and physical exercise under the supervision of a physician. Job Description Researches acute and chronic physiological adaptations to physical activity, gaining a full understanding of how a chronic disease affects an individual prior to recommending exercise. Analyzes a patient's medical history to assess their risk during exercise and to determine the best possible exercise and fitness regimen for the patient. Performs fitness and stress tests with medical equipment and analyzes the resulting patient data. Measures blood pressure, oxygen usage, heart rhythm and other key patient health indicators. Develops exercise programs to improve patient's health. Conducts controlled investigations of responses and adaptations to muscular activity. Performs dietary intake assessments and counsels on modifications needed, referring to dietitian as necessary in order to achieve goals. Depending on location, may perform 12 lead EKGs/monitors. Conducts weight management assessments and calculates body mass index (BMI) to determine proper category; develops goals for weight loss. Interprets values of lipid tests such as low-density lipoprotein-cholesterol (LDL-C), high-density lipoprotein-cholesterol (HDL-C), total cholesterol, and triglycerides. Assists with diabetes management and tobacco cessation programs. Develops risk reduction and behavior modification plans to minimize future risk of chronic diseases and illness. Qualifications Bachelor’s degree required, preferably in exercise science, kinesiology, human performance and fitness human biology or a related field. Master’s degree preferred. Experience in exercise program planning and working with chronic diseases and illness preferred. Possesses a thorough understanding of the physiological basis of activity and the ability to prescribe and instruct exercise according to American College of Sports Medicine (ACSM) and National Strength and Conditioning Association (NSCA) guidelines. American College of Sports Medicine (ACSM) Certified Clinical Exercise Physiologist (CCEP) certification within two years of hire preferred. Basic Life Support (BLS) certified within 60 days of hire required. Depending on location, Advanced Cardiac Life Support (ACLS) certification within the first year of hire preferred. Sanford Health, the largest rural health system in the United States, is dedicated to transforming the health care experience and providing access to world-class health care in America’s heartland. Headquartered in Sioux Falls, South Dakota, the organization has 53,000 employees and serves over 2 million patients and nearly 425,000 health plan members across the upper Midwest including South Dakota, North Dakota, Minnesota, Wyoming, Iowa, Wisconsin and the Upper Peninsula of Michigan. The integrated nonprofit health system includes a network of 56 hospitals, 288 clinic locations, 147 senior care communities, 4,000 physicians and advanced practice providers and nearly 1,500 active clinical trials and studies. The organization’s transformational virtual care initiative brings patients closer to care with access to 78 specialties.
